What Is Acute Back Pain?

The acute backache is common muscle-skeletal disorder. It occurs suddenly, without warning, and can last a few days or weeks. Back Shoulder Blade Pain Relief However, in some cases it can become a chronic problem if it is not treated. Additionally, it may make sitting and standing uncomfortable. Patients suffering from acute back pain might also experience muscles spasms in their hips and lower back.

The treatment of acute back pain can be achieved with medication, and rehabilitation, as well as chiropractic treatment. Certain treatments may help alleviate pain and can be used to prevent back pain in the future. In extreme cases treatment options could be necessary. For instance, if pain is caused by a tumor or kidney stone, the physician may recommend surgery.

Anyone suffering with acute back pain must visit their doctor as quickly as possible. A thorough medical history as well as a physical examination should be conducted. What Is The Most Common Reason For Back Pain? Back Shoulder Blade Pain Relief

The most common is a tension on the muscles in the back. It is typically caused by lifting an large item, sudden motions, or injuries from sports. Other are diseases or injuries to the disks between the vertebrae in the spine. If one of these discs expands or ruptures, it can put pressure on nerves. If the disk is damaged, it will often appear on a spine X-ray.

Back pain can also be due to osteoporosis which is a progressive bone degenerative disorder. It is a frequent cause of back pain and often results in brittle, porous bones. Osteoporosis can result in painful compression fractures, which could be caused by falls or lifting heavy objects.

Can Bad Posture Cause Back Pain?

It’s true that poor posture can lead to various aches and pains, from stiffness in the neck to backaches. If it is not taken care of it can result in damage to discs and joints in the body. While it’s impossible to stop the negative effects of poor posture, there are a number of exercises can be recommended to correct any problem.

There are many causes of back discomfort, but the most prevalent are physical causes or poor posture. Being inactive puts more stress on the spinal column, which causes pressure on weak muscles supporting it. Lifestyle changes and sudden lifting may also trigger back discomfort. Therefore, the correct posture can improve the condition of back pain, and also reduce the need for back surgery.

Poor posture can affect the spine’s alignment and can place the head ahead of the shoulders. As well as stressing the vertebrae, it also strains the ligaments and muscles in the neck. Also, poor posture can create strain in the trapezius muscles which are located at the base of the neck and stretch across the shoulders and middle of the back.
